Why do you need a slate pool table?

Billiard table manufacturers use slate because of its flatness and sheer weight. Slate adds hundreds of pounds of weight to a pool table, which adds stability and allows for precise billiards play.

Is it OK to stand on a slate pool table?

The key part to understanding why a pool table shouldn't be stood upon is its slate. The slate is a piece of flat stone that is often milled to precision, then covered in a cloth for pool. The slate is very fragile, and most importantly a very brittle material that doesn't offer much in the way of structural support.

How hard is it to break a slate pool table?

Table slate is amazingly tough stuff, especially with the cloth covering, which helps distribute and dampen the force some. Jump shots, massé shots, and tapping down (even hard) will not cause damage to the slate, assuming there isn't a big hole in the cloth at the spot of impact.

How much does an 8 foot slate pool table weigh?

The average pool table weights for slate bed pool tables are: 6-Foot Table – 500 Pounds. 7-Foot Table – 700 Pounds. 8-Foot Table – 1,000 Pounds.

What's the point of a pool table without pockets?

Carom billiards tables have no pockets or opening where balls are sunk, that snooker and pool tables do have. In its simplest form, the object of carom billiards games is to score points or "counts" by bouncing one's own ball, called a cue ball, off of the other two balls on the table.

How much does it cost to Refelt a pool table?

It costs $300 on average to refelt a pool table, with a typical price range of $250 to $300. You may pay as little as $150 or as much as $500. Pool tables come in three sizes, and size affects the price. The cost of pool table refelting is fairly evenly split between materials and labor.

What's the heaviest part of a pool table?

The heaviest part of your pool table is the slate. Our tables feature 3 pieces of slate fitted to ensure perfect play, and these pieces weigh in between 150-250 pounds each.
